Douglas Wings & Things Festival and Fly-in

        Spring blooms with excitement as Douglas-Coffee County gears up for the 3rd Annual
      Wings & Things Festival and Fly-in on Saturday, March 22, 2025, from 9am to 4pm at the
      Douglas Municipal Airport.
      Celebrating our rich World
      War  II  heritage,  this  festi-
      val boasts the largest intact
      airbase  with  a  museum  in
        Georgia.   Explore  historic
      aircraft,  military  vehicles,
      a  car  show,  vendors,  kids’
      activities,  live  entertain-
      ment,  and  tantalizing  food
      trucks.   Pilots  from  across
      the  country  will  showcase
      their aircraft, while  visitors
      can enjoy flights on a Huey
      helicopter  or WWII-era
      planes  and  tours  of  the
      WWII  Airbase  Museum.
      This  free,   family-friendly
      event  promises  fun  and
        education for all ages.
